Transaction 62bf17fd5f0eb6643eaa980dc2cf4d39b4bef877770a954b32e2edc43ea53e86

1 Input
2 Outputs
  • 62bf17fd5f0eb6643eaa980dc2cf4d39b4bef877770a954b32e2edc43ea53e86:0
  • value  777200
    address  1KZ67egSAgGD4dZKk1pR7DSnCChEPuW4M4
  • 62bf17fd5f0eb6643eaa980dc2cf4d39b4bef877770a954b32e2edc43ea53e86:1
  • value  7299371
    address  1Jmycz2uvtX2BwskWzxsopRroH6TBsk59D